BIO
With a refreshing and honest voice, Lilly Moss has a presence as powerful as her story.
Born and raised in Bethlehem, Pennsylvania, Lilly Moss discovered her love for music at an early age. By sixth grade she was taking vocal lessons, adding piano by eighth, and by 16 she was writing songs influenced by artists like Jason Isbell and Adele. Her first live performance at 17 confirmed her passion for pursuing a career in music.
At just 19, Lilly released her debut album Meet Me on Broadway (2024). Two tracks—“Heartbreak Summer” and “Love Me Not”—landed on Spotify’s All New Country editorial playlist, followed by national recognition as a semi-finalist in the Unsigned Only Music Competition, and regional recognition as ArtsQuest’s Emerging Artist of the Year.
Known for her emotional authenticity and powerful live performances, Lilly has a rare ability to connect deeply with audiences, as she continues to grow a devoted and engaged fanbase.
A childhood cancer survivor, Lilly is equally committed to paying it forward. She has performed at the Pediatric Cancer Foundation’s Galas, supports Blood Cancers United (LLS), and co-hosts the annual Dream Come True Telethon.
In 2025, Lilly delivered the keynote at the Grant Thornton Invitational Pro-Am Gala, earning a standing ovation before performing a duet of “God Gave Me a Girl” with country star Russell Dickerson—one of the evening’s most memorable moments benefitting CureSearch for Children’s Cancer.
Lilly continues to use her platform to advocate for childhood cancer awareness while pursuing her musical dreams, establishing herself as a standout artist, role model, and voice for her generation.
